Since nobodies posted it yet, the Ohio State results are available here: tiny.cc/ohso
And in the interest of full transparency, I'll point out that we had a scoring error (which I take full, personal responsibility for) in how we applied a penalty in Electric Vehicle. As a result of that, Mentor was announced at the award's ceremony as being the 2nd place team (and going to Nationals), while Centerville was the 4th place team. Someone from the Mentor team had the great integrity to immediately point out this error at the end of the ceremony, which after correcting resulted in Centerville coming in 2nd place overall and Mentor in 3rd. We have a clearly documented policy similar to that at Nationals that says results are tentative until 1 hour after the ceremony.
I'm heartbroken about the emotional rollercoaster this put all the students involved in, and hope it doesn't discourage anyone from future participation in Science Olympiad.
